#b04c0a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b04c0a is composed of 69% red, 29.8%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 23.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 36.5%. #b04c0a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9814 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#b04c0a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b04c0a has RGB values of R:176, G:76,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.94,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11553802.

Hex triplet b04c0a #b04c0a
RGB Decimal 176, 76, 10 rgb(176,76,10)
RGB Percent 69, 29.8, 3.9 rgb(69%,29.8%,3.9%)
CMYK 0, 57, 94, 31
HSL 23.9°, 89.2, 36.5 hsl(23.9,89.2%,36.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 23.9°, 94.3, 69
Web Safe 993300 #993300
CIE-LAB 44.834, 37.857, 52.21
XYZ 20.545, 14.423, 1.989
xyY 0.556, 0.39, 14.423
CIE-LCH 44.834, 64.491, 54.055
CIE-LUV 44.834, 81.912, 38.562
Hunter-Lab 37.978, 30.101, 23.479
Binary 10110000, 01001100, 00001010

Shades and Tints of #b04c0a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b04c0a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615c59 is the less saturated color, while #b74b03 is the most saturated one.
